What is a German shepherd?

german shepherd kaufen Shepherds are also referred to as GSDs. They are renowned for their wolf-like appearance determination and loyalty, as well as a the noble nature of their disposition. They are intelligent dogs that excel when paired with active families and people, altdeutscher schäferhund kaufen including those with children. They are great police dogs, herding dogs and service dogs, but they thrive as companions too. They love to play fetch and walk with their owners, and take part in obedience classes. They are excellent running partners because of their athleticism and speed.

GSDs are loving, loyal dogs. However, they have to be taught regularly to avoid undesirable behaviors like jumping or nipping. They need a lot of exercise, which is why they are best suited to homes with big yards and Deutscher schäferhund kaufen schweiz lots of outdoor time. They're also very adaptable and will adjust well to a new home environment, versus an outdoor farm or kennel. If you are limited in outdoor time such as a walker, or dog-sitting arrangement may be necessary to ensure your GSD gets the exercise they require.

When you are choosing the breed of German Shepherd, look for a responsible breeder who has the dog's parents health-tested. The breeder should also be able to answer any questions you have regarding the puppy's bloodlines or history. This is vital, as GSDs are susceptible to certain conditions such as elbow and hip disprolasia, as well as eye diseases, like myelopathy and cataracts.

It is also advisable to inquire with the breeder about genetic tests that may be available for your German Shepherd puppy. These tests can reduce your pup's risk for developing Von Willebrand disease which is a genetic bleeding disorder.

Characteristics

German Shepherds are intelligent and loyal. They're also fun. They are great companions They also excel in herding, tracking as well as search and rescue and even protection work. They are extremely protective of their owners and are able to quickly learn the difference between family and strangers. Sheepdogs are able to form strong bonds with their owners and are protective of their children. It is crucial to socialize and train them at an early age to avoid territoriality and aggression.

Responsible breeders don't put a puppy in a box and ship it across the country or around the world to be cared for by someone who didn't take the time to meet the dog, assess their temperament and determine if they're suitable for the house they will be living in. They should be able to meet any potential buyers and provide a complete health certificate for both parents, as well as pedigree information.

This breed is known for its muscular build which allows for fluid movement and optimal performance. The head is broad and full, with a beautiful expression and an alert yet calm manner. Some serious shortcomings include a insecurity or timid behavior and nervousness. The teeth are sturdy and evenly spaced in a bite that is scissors. The nose is dark, and the eyes are medium-sized size, with a bright expressive expression.

A German Shepherd of high-quality is a confident and frightened dog. He will approach and communicate with people easily however he should show a moderate amount of aloofness towards strangers. He should be able to adapt quickly to new situations and display a level of concentration that is balanced with an element of enthusiasm.

The structure of the German Shepherd is designed for effective locomotion, especially when trotting. The neck is strong and the back is well-built with a sturdy loin. The chest is well developed and the ribs are visible. The forelegs are strong, straight line, and a smooth gait.

German Shepherds are intelligent and active dogs. They require a lot of physical and mental stimulation to remain happy and healthy. This includes plenty of leash controlled walks and supervised free play in safe, fenced-in areas. This helps to burn off energy and avoids disruptive behavior caused by frustration or the accumulation of energy.

While the herding instinct is strong in these dogs, they are extremely trainable and are able to master many different tasks. They're excellent police dogs and search and rescue dogs as well as loving family pets with a deep affection for their people. Their grit and sense of duty make them excellent service dogs for visually impaired and disabled individuals.

As puppies, the dogs need to be socialized with humans and animals so that they can become comfortable with strangers. This will help them become responsible adults. It is important to start them in obedience classes early to help establish the foundations for good behavior and obedience.

They require constant medical attention as they get older, and especially. These routine evaluations help catch and prevent common dog diseases like distemper and rabies. They also offer vital checks for breed-related conditions like elbow dysplasias, cauda-equina and perianal fstulas.

German Shepherds, just like all dogs, require regular grooming in order to maintain the health of their coat and to reduce the amount of shed. They can be groomed every week or more often as required, based on their length of coat. They should be bathed only according to the instructions of your vet, as they are sensitive to too much moisture.
